The Context
To understand this signal, we must map the global liquidity landscape. The semiconductor industry is bifurcated into two distinct regimes. On one side, AI-related advanced nodes (3nm, 2nm, CoWoS) operate near full capacity, with utilization rates above 95%. On the other side, mature nodes (28nm and above) face excess supply and weakening demand from consumer electronics, automotive, and industrial IoT. This is not a new insight—I flagged this structural divergence in my Q1 2025 macro report—but the market's reaction crystallized it.
The UBS and Barclays analysts maintained their bullish outlooks, citing that compute demand still exceeds available supply. They are correct, but only for the narrow AI segment. The Wells Fargo strategist who called the sell-off "one of the most severe emotional deteriorations on record" was not wrong either—he was measuring sentiment, not fundamentals. The truth lies at the intersection of these two observations: the AI structural demand is intact, but the market's patience for capital-intensive rollouts is thinning.
The Core
This is where the crypto AI narrative becomes relevant. Over the past 18 months, the crypto market has spawned dozens of projects claiming to democratize AI compute—Render Network, Bittensor, Akash Network, io.net, and others. These tokens promise to aggregate idle GPU capacity and offer it to AI developers at lower costs than cloud giants like AWS or Azure. Their valuations skyrocketed during the AI narrative frenzy of early 2024, with some tokens gaining over 500%.
But the semiconductor sell-off exposes their fragility. The same market forces that punished DRAM stocks—concerns about HBM (high-bandwidth memory) capital expenditure returns, GPU shortages, and the gap between hype and deployment—apply directly to crypto AI tokens. Most of these projects depend on the same hardware supply chains. If GPU prices fall due to excess supply in non-AI segments, the economic models of these networks could collapse. Conversely, if AI-specific chips remain scarce and expensive, the cost to run these decentralized compute networks may become prohibitive.
Let me share a real example from my audit work. In late 2023, I evaluated Render Network's tokenomics for a fund. The model assumed a steady decline in GPU rental costs as more suppliers joined the network. But the assumption ignored the structural shortage of high-end GPUs (H100s, B100s) caused by hyperscalers hoarding capacity. The network's actual utilization rate hovered around 30% of projected levels. The token price reflected narrative, not usage. That narrative is now being stress-tested by the semiconductor signal.

Structural Indicators to Watch
Three signals will determine the fate of crypto AI tokens in this cycle:
- HBM pricing and availability: If HBM costs remain stubbornly high due to production complexity, decentralized networks that rely on top-tier GPUs will suffer. If costs drop, their models improve.
- Hyperscaler capital expenditure guidance: Microsoft, Amazon, and Google are the 800-pound gorillas. Their quarterly earnings calls will reveal whether AI infrastructure spending accelerates or plateaus. Any hint of a slowdown will hit crypto AI tokens twice—once on sentiment, once on actual demand for alternative compute.
- On-chain utilization metrics: Stop looking at token prices. Look at the actual jobs processed on Render, the number of subnets on Bittensor, the sustained uptime on Akash. If these metrics grow while prices decline, the sell-off is a gift. If they stagnate, the narrative is dead.
